dbflute_fess/_readme.txt
Directory for DBFlute client manage.bat(sh) => 21 (jdbc): A execution command of JDBC task which gets your schema info and saves it to SchemaXML located to the "schema" directory. This task should be executed after ReplaceSchema task and before other tasks(e.g. Generate, Document task). manage.bat(sh) => 22 (doc): A execution command of Document task which creates documents, for example, SchemaHTML, HistoryHTML to the "output/doc" directory.
